如何批量获取以太坊钱包:全面指南

随着区块链技术的快速发展,以太坊作为最具代表性的智能合约平台之一,受到越来越多投资者和开发者的青睐。理解如何有效地管理以太坊钱包,尤其是批量获取以太坊钱包,成为许多用户关注的焦点。本文旨在提供一份详尽的指南,帮助用户理解批量获取以太坊钱包的整个过程,并回答用户可能遇到的一些关键问题。

1. 什么是以太坊钱包?

以太坊钱包是一个软件程序或硬件设备,能够存储用户的以太币(ETH)和各种基于以太坊平台的代币。与传统银行账户不同,以太坊钱包不会存储货币本身,而是存储与用户资产相关的密钥,这些密钥用于进行交易和签名。用户可以选择不同类型的钱包,例如热钱包(在线钱包)和冷钱包(离线钱包),根据自身需求和安全性选择合适的钱包类型。

2. 为什么需要批量获取以太坊钱包?

批量获取以太坊钱包的需求主要集中在以下几种情况:

  • 项目开发者:许多区块链项目开发者需要为测试和开发目的创建多个钱包,以便测试智能合约或分发代币。
  • 投资者:一些投资者可能希望同时管理多个钱包,以便分散风险和管理不同的资产。
  • 交易所和服务平台:交易所或平台在用户聚集阶段可能需要批量创建用户钱包,以便快速响应市场需求。

3. 如何批量获取以太坊钱包?

批量获取以太坊钱包的方法主要有几种:

3.1 使用专用工具和库

市面上有一些专用的库和工具可以帮助用户批量生成以太坊钱包,常用的有Node.js中的web3.js库和JavaScript的ethers.js库。这些工具可以通过简单的代码迅速生成多个钱包地址和对应的私钥。


const ethers = require('ethers');

let wallets = [];
for (let i = 0; i < 10; i  ) {
    const wallet = ethers.Wallet.createRandom();
    wallets.push(wallet);
}
console.log(wallets);

如上代码可以生成10个随机的以太坊钱包及其私钥,用户可以根据需要修改生成的数量。

3.2 使用批量生成服务

与大多数流程相比,利用一些在线服务提供的批量生成钱包功能会简单得多。这些服务通常会要求用户提供所需钱包的数量,并根据这些需求生成地址和私钥。用户在使用这些服务时需谨慎,以防数据安全问题。

3.3 自建生成系统

对于有技术背景的用户,自建一套以太坊钱包生成系统将是一个较为安全的选择。通过使用相关的库和API接口,可以通过程序代码生成并保存钱包信息。尽量确保生成过程不与互联网连接,以最大程度提高安全性,保护生成的私钥不被外界获取。

4. 批量获取以太坊钱包的注意事项

在批量获取以太坊钱包时,用户应注意以下几点:

  • 私钥管理:私钥是一切以太坊资产的安全保障,务必做好私钥备份和管理,推荐使用加密方式储存。
  • 安全性:使用的工具与库需来源于可信任的渠道,避免使用不明来源的工具,容易导致财产损失。
  • 法律合规性:在某些国家,批量创建钱包可能涉及法律风险,尤其是用于洗钱等不当用途,务必遵循当地法律法规。

常见问题解答

如何安全地存储以太坊钱包的私钥?

私钥是以太坊钱包的核心,负责授权和签名交易,因此必须安全存储。

  • 使用硬件钱包:硬件钱包是存储私钥的最安全方式。它们不会与互联网直接连接,降低了黑客攻击的风险。
  • 加密备份:如果需将私钥储存在电子设备中,务必加密并定期更换密码,以减少被盗的机会。
  • 多个备份途径:建议在不同地点存储多个私钥备份,避免因意外情况(如自然灾害)导致备份损失。

批量获取以太坊钱包后,如何确保安全性?

获取以太坊钱包后,确保安全性需采取多方面的措施:

  • 使用安全的网络环境:在可信的网络环境中创建和管理钱包,避免在公共网络或不安全环境下进行交易。
  • 定期检查钱包余额与交易记录:定期检查钱包的交易记录,及时发现异常或者未授权交易。
  • 开启双重身份验证:如果平台支持双重身份验证,务必开启,增加一层安全防护。

如何针对不同需求选择钱包类型?

根据不同用途,选择合适的钱包类型至关重要:

  • 热钱包:适合频繁交易和使用的场合,方便快捷,但因常连网而可能面临较高风险。
  • 冷钱包:适用于长期存储,安全性较高,适合长时间不动用的资产,但在需要用时操作较为繁琐。
  • 硬件钱包:适合高价值资产的长期保管,具有极高的安全性,非常适合长期持有的投资者。

怎样高效管理多个以太坊钱包?

有效管理多个以太坊钱包可以采取以下步骤:

  • 集中管理工具:可使用一些综合管理工具或平台,如MetaMask,方便用户在一个地方查看所有的钱包及其余额。
  • 标签和分类:可以给不同的钱包打上标签或分类,例如个人资产、项目开发、测试等,更容易管理和访问。
  • 定期审查:定期审查各个钱包的使用情况,关注余额和交易历史,确保及时发现问题。

通过以上方法,用户不但能有效获取和管理以太坊钱包,还能确保信息安全,提高资产管理的效率。无论是出于项目开发、投资,还是作为普通用户,理解并掌握批量获取以太坊钱包的技巧是相当重要的。当继续深入学习和探索这个领域的时候,保持警觉和专业知识不仅是保障自己资产安全的不二法门,也是每一个加密货币用户应该追求的目标。